Job description

Posted Tuesday, September 8, 2026 at 10:00 AM

JOB DETAILS:

Shift

1st/Day Shift

Location

In - Shop

Schedule

Work schedule to be provided by leader

Salary Range

$41.48 - $70.54 Per Hour

JOB SUMMARY:

Accept responsibility for assigned service areas. Exercise leadership control of assigned shift(s). Direct personnel to perform related support activities. Appraise assigned employees’ performance. Meet production schedules. Maintain area equipment and tools. Coordinate jobs between shifts and with other departments. Assist in handling client calls. Solve workflow and procedural problems. Provide failure analysis and technical information support as needed.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:
  • Directly supervises employees.
  • Prioritizes workflow and assign jobs to technicians.
  • Coordinates and schedules required work with other areas.
  • Communicates with clients as needed.
  • Operates within budgets, meeting standards for flat rates, bids, and estimates.
  • Conducts annual appraisals for assigned employees.
  • Controls repair job costs and keeps costs within budget.
  • Maintains records and data.
  • Create an environment of ownership and personal accountability where each person is responsible and accountable for their performance.
  • Work safely at all times. Adhere to all applicable safety policies. Comply with all company policies, procedures, and standards.
ADDITIONAL RESPONSIBILITIES:
  • Uses professional interpersonal skills to select, supervise, train, and develop subordinates.
  • Ensures assigned employees are trained, motivated and functioning according to their job descriptions.
  • Investigates possible re-work and warranty situations.
  • Determines proper repair methods.
  • Functions as a Service Technician to assist in meeting deadlines.
  • Maintains equipment and tools in work area; keep work area clean and safe.
  • Monitors and reviews all work orders in work area.
  • Obtains technical assistance in difficult and unusual conditions.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
  • Works within and promotes corporate values.
KNOWLEDGE SKILLS AND ABILITIES:
  • Must have interpersonal and communication skills sufficient to oversee, motivate, direct, train, and evaluate people and to write reports.
  • Must be able to organize jobs into a logical operational sequence and provide leadership to assigned technicians.
  • Must be able to utilize diagnostic equipment to evaluate problems and make repair decisions.
  • Must know and be able to use EMPIRE and Caterpillar Service Systems, procedures, and publications.
  • Must have acceptable attendance to meet all company standards and requirements.
  • Must have extensive technical knowledge of CAT machine components and systems in order to troubleshoot problems and train others.
E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E:
  • High school diploma or General Education Degree (GED).
  • Strong technical background required.
  • Completion of TRAIN test evaluation.
  • Must be able to communicate (speak, read, comprehend, write) in English.
PHYSICAL DEMANDS:

The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

  • While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to sit, use hands, talk or hear, stand, walk, reach with hands and arms, climb or balance, and stoop or kneel.
  • The employee is regularly required to lift and/or move up to 25 pounds and occasionally required to lift and/or move up to 60 pounds.
  • Specific vision abilities required by this job include close, distance, and peripheral vision.
  • May be required to operate a forklift with appropriate certification(s).
  • This position is designated as a "Safety-Sensitive Position". A Safety-Sensitive Position includes tasks or duties that EMPIRE in good faith believes could affect the safety or health of the employee performing the task or others.
WORK ENVIRONMENT:

The work environment characteristics described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

  • While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ly exposed to moving mechanical parts; high, precarious places; and outside weather conditions.
  • The employee is frequently exposed to wet and/or humid conditions, extreme cold, and extreme heat.
  • The noise level in the work environment is usually loud.
